Wilson Combat has introduced the America 250th Limited Edition 1911 Series, a special commemorative lineup of custom 1911 pistols created to honor the 250th anniversary of American independence.

Built on a fully custom Wilson Combat 1911 platform, the America 250th series combines the iconic American fighting pistol with exclusive engraving created specifically for the United States Semiquincentennial. Each pistol is built in all domestically sourced stainless steel and finished with a unique serialized frame, deluxe satin-polished flats, glass-beaded rounds, gold-bead front sight, hand-checkered rear slide, magwell, ambidextrous safety, fluted chamber, carry cuts and other premium custom features.

The series is offered in two distinct engraving treatments.

Hand Engraved America 250

The first twenty-five pistols, Serials 1–25, are personally hand engraved by renowned master engraver Wayne D'Angelo, making them the most exclusive expression of the America 250th series. These pistols represent a rare opportunity to own a true hand-engraved Wilson Combat 1911 created for one of the most significant milestones in American history.

Laser Engraved America 250

Beginning with Serial 26 and beyond, the America 250th design is rendered in-house using precision laser engraving. These models carry the same commemorative engraving pattern and visual theme as the hand-engraved originals, while offering collectors and Wilson Combat customers broader access to the series.
